DIAGNOS Inc. (OTCMKTS:DGNOF) Sees Large Increase in Short Interest

DIAGNOS Inc. (OTCMKTS:DGNOFGet Free Report) saw a large increase in short interest in the month of August. As of August 31st, there was short interest totaling 10 shares, an increase of ? from the August 15th total of 0 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 167,416 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.0 days. Currently, 0.0% of the company’s stock are short sold.

DIAGNOS Stock Performance

Shares of DIAGNOS stock opened at $0.36 on Wednesday. The stock has a market cap of $43.59 million, a PE ratio of -8.89 and a beta of 0.01.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$0.25 and a 200-day simple moving average of $0.20. The company has a quick ratio of 1.49, a current ratio of 1.49 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.33. DIAGNOS has a 12 month low of $0.13 and a 12 month high of $0.38.

DIAGNOS Inc provides software-based services primarily in Canada, the United States, Colombia, Spain, Mexico, Saudi Arabia, and Costa Rica. The company offers healthcare services through Computer Assisted Retina Analysis, a web-based software tool that assists healthcare professionals for the detection of diabetic retinopathy; and allows eye care specialist to visualize both normal retinal landmarks and pathological changes. It also provides various consulting services in the fields of data analysis and artificial intelligence.
